Asbestos is a hazardous substance that can cause serious health issues. People who have been exposed to asbestos are at risk of developing diseases, such as mesothelioma and lung cancer. These illnesses are usually due to the negligence of manufacturers, who knew asbestos was dangerous but did not inform their workers. Asbestos suits seek compensation from these negligent corporations.

In New York, victims are given three years from the date of their diagnosis to file a lawsuit. However, this timeline may be extended if the patient's condition is advancing or they have been diagnosed with mesothelioma in past. This is known as the "discovery rule." asbestos lawyer lawsuits usually comprise a compensation claim against a company that manufactured or distributed asbestos products, and any other companies who exposed their workers to asbestos attorneys-containing substances. The lawsuits are filed to seek damages for medical expenses, lost wages and pain and suffering. Compensation for these damages is usually much higher than what is available through workers' compensation.

Many asbestos companies have gone bankrupt due to the number of lawsuits brought against them. As a result billions of dollars have been put aside in asbestos trust funds to compensate victims and their families.
